:>So if I look at the SMTP.log file on my client machine and it says
:>SMTP: 12:43:10 [tx] EHLO ws1
:>SMTP: 12:43:10 [rx] 502 unimplemented command
:>SMTP: 12:43:10 [tx] HELO ws1
:>SMTP: 12:43:10 [rx] 250 hello 127.0.0.1
:>
:>since it doesn't recognize the EHLO, does that mean either the mail 
:>server doesn't support ESMTP ?
:
:We just went through one of these (was it yours?) where the 
:EHLO wasn't 
:understood, because Outlook wasn't talking to IMail, but was 
:really talking 
:to a firewall or other mail server.  If you see a bunch of 
:*****'s in a 
:line prior to the ones above, you're dealing with a firewall 
:mucking with 
:the SMTP transaction.
